0.题目
1. 双端队列
class Solution:
def zigzagLevelOrder(self, root: TreeNode) -> List[List[int]]:
if not root:
return []
c=1
res = []
parent = deque()
parent.append(root)
while parent: # 结点入数组
tmp = []
l = len(parent)
for i in range(l):
# print(parent)
if c==1: #顺序
p = parent.popleft()
tmp.append(p.val)
if p.left: parent.append(p.left) #加在后面
if p.right: parent.append(p.right)

订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



